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
72 GREAT OXCROFT Terraced £232,014 £149,000 30 Apr 2014
73 GREAT OXCROFT Terraced £259,563 £240,000 12 Nov 2021
81 GREAT OXCROFT Terraced £254,971 £137,000 15 Apr 2005
82 GREAT OXCROFT Terraced £245,730 £44,500 30 Sep 1996
83 GREAT OXCROFT Terraced £338,356 £270,000 23 Mar 2018
84 GREAT OXCROFT Terraced £344,314 £300,000 11 Dec 2020
85 GREAT OXCROFT Terraced £210,706 £44,500 14 Apr 1998
86 GREAT OXCROFT Terraced £274,248 £167,000 26 Jan 2007
87 GREAT OXCROFT Terraced £273,419 £185,000 13 Feb 2015